What is the difference between Operator Internship vs Machine Operator?
| Aspect | Operator Internship | Machine Operator |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| High school diploma or equivalent; some technical training | High school diploma; technical certification often preferred |
| Work Environment | Internship setting, supervised, learning-focused | Full-time, hands-on in manufacturing or industrial settings |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Internship programs in manufacturing, energy, or industrial sectors | Manufacturing plants, factories, industrial facilities |
| Common Search & Comparison | Yes | Yes |
The main difference between an Operator Internship and a Machine Operator is that an internship is a training position designed for learning and gaining experience, often with supervision, while a Machine Operator is a full-time role responsible for operating machinery independently. Internships serve as a stepping stone into the industry, whereas Machine Operators are experienced workers performing essential operational tasks.

Job description
Key Responsibilities:
Develop and optimize advanced manufacturing processes including material selection, parameter adjustments, equipment metrology, and system design
Conduct feasibility studies and pathfinding activities to support innovative device architectures and manufacturing roadmaps
Design and implement modifications to operating equipment to improve efficiency and production output
Collaborate with equipment and material suppliers to establish enabling technology solutions and integrate them into manufacturing processes
Perform process technology feasibility studies using theoretical simulations and practical engineering methods
Stay informed on industry trends and technological advancements to align manufacturing processes with evolving semiconductor needs
Drive the development of cost-sensitive technology roadmaps in partnership with vendors and internal stakeholders
Minimum qualifications are required to be initially considered for this position. Preferred qualifications are in addition to the minimum requirements and are considered a plus factor in identifying top candidates. Requirements listed would be obtained through a combination of industry relevant job experience, internship experiences and or schoolwork/classes/research.
Minimum Qualifications:
PhD in a STEM discipline such as Electrical Engineering, Materials Science, Applied Physics, Chemical Engineering, Chemistry, or a closely related field with at least 6+ months relevant experience
Relevant experience includes, but is not limited to:
Fundamental knowledge of plasma physics, surface reactions, thin film processes, and semiconductor materials
Experience with experimental design, data collection, and statistical analysis
Ability to analyze process results and clearly document findings in technical reports and presentations
Strong problem solving skills and ability to work independently while collaborating in cross functional teams
Effective written and verbal communication skills in a technical environment
Willingness to work in a fab or lab environment and follow strict safety and contamination control protocols
Preferred Qualifications:
PhD research focus specifically related to plasma etch, pattern transfer, or advanced logic/memory process integration
Hands on experience with production or pilot line dry etch tools (e.g., Lam, Applied Materials, TEL, ASM, Hitachi)
Knowledge of advanced node challenges such as high aspect ratio etching, CD control, etch selectivity, and damage mitigation
Experience with Design of Experiments (DOE) and statistical process control (SPC)
Familiarity with process integration, yield learning, or technology development methodologies
Programming or scripting experience for data analysis or automation (e.g., Python, MATLAB, JMP, or similar tools)
Exposure to foundry or industrial semiconductor Research and Development environments through internships, collaborations, or joint research programs
Ability to manage multiple experiments or development tasks in a fast paced, manufacturing driven Research and Development setting
Demonstrated interest in transitioning academic research into high volume manufacturing solutions
Hands on research experience with dry etch-related topics (e.g., plasma etching, RIE, ICP, ALE) through academic research, dissertation work, or internships
Working understanding of semiconductor manufacturing process flows and device structures
Familiarity with common semiconductor characterization techniques (e.g., SEM, TEM, AFM, XPS, ellipsometry)
